tag_insight = "The following package is affected: openttd
CVE-2011-3341
Multiple off-by-one errors in order_cmd.cpp in OpenTTD before 1.1.3
allow remote attackers to cause a denial of service (daemon crash) or
possibly execute arbitrary code via a crafted CMD_INSERT_ORDER
command.";
